I was thinking of plexiglass to enclose the top, just so it wouldn’t be so dark? Is that a bad idea??
Yes, hens like privacy. They're also prey animals so being under constant observation would cause their health to deteriorate.
You can add windows, of course. I'd put a window at the end on hinges fir cleaning. And ventilation lets in light, one square foot per bird, I'd just leave a gap at the top of the wall under the roof overhang, the entire length, both sides, 4 inches.

Another thing to note if you went the plexiglass route, it's a good way to cook your birds in the summertime. 😬 Plexiglass isn't quite as bad as glass, but sunlight through plexiglass will intensify the heat, and doing an entire enclosure with the stuff will turn it into an oven when it's hot. It's not such a problem if it's used as a window, but using it for anything more, especially without good ventilation would turn anything into a greenhouse style environment.
